About the role

Role Title: STEM AI Agent Research Specialist

Location: Remote

micro1 is engaging STEM AI Agent Research Specialists to contribute to a customer's advanced AI training project. In this role, you'll apply your expertise to help train next-generation AI systems. Your work will shape how models learn, reason, and perform through high-quality, real-world input. No prior experience in AI is required — your domain knowledge is what matters. This engagement focuses on reviewing and analyzing historical session traces from local or agentic AI tools used in rigorous STEM research or technical problem-solving. Strong written and verbal communication skills are essential, as you will assess, document, and articulate technical processes and insights for project deliverables.

Scope of Work

• Review, curate, and submit historical session traces from local or agentic AI tools (e.g., Claude Code, Claude Cowork, Codex, Claude for Life Sciences, OpenCode) demonstrating substantive STEM research or technical workflows. • Analyze and validate the technical depth and integrity of AI-assisted problem-solving, ensuring sessions involve multi-step reasoning and authentic human guidance. • Document research methodologies, problem-solving approaches, and points of human intervention within session traces. • Evaluate the effectiveness and limitations of agentic AI tools in STEM research contexts, highlighting areas for improvement or model training. • Produce clear, concise written explanations outlining session processes, outputs, and validation steps. • Provide constructive feedback on the AI’s performance, accuracy, and reasoning based on professional STEM experience.

Preferred Qualifications

• Advanced academic or professional background in a STEM field (science, technology, engineering, or mathematics). • First-hand experience using local or agentic AI tools for research or technical projects, beyond web-based chatbots. • Access to and familiarity with historical session data involving STEM or technical workflows. • Strong skills in scientific reasoning, technical research, data analysis, code debugging, and research documentation. • Demonstrated ability to guide, challenge, and validate AI-generated outputs within complex problem-solving scenarios. • Excellent written and verbal communication skills for clear technical documentation and feedback. • Experience with AI evaluation, output validation, and iterative research methods is highly valued.
